A mass burial site suspected of containing 30 victims of The Great Plague of 1665 has been unearthed at Crossrail's Liverpool Street site in the City of London.The discovery was found during excavation of the Bedlam burial ground at Crossrail's Liverpool Street site, which will allow construction of the eastern entrance of the new station.Jay Carver, Crossrail Lead Archaeologist, said: "The construction of Crossrail gives us a rare opportunity to study previously inaccessible areas of...
